Revolutionizing Athletic Performance Through Data
One of the most significant impacts of Dublin’s tech sector on sports is the transformation of athletic performance analysis. Companies based in Dublin are at the forefront of developing sophisticated data-gathering tools and AI-powered platforms. These technologies enable coaches and athletes to gain deeper insights into training regimes, identify areas for improvement, and prevent injuries through predictive analytics. Wearable devices, motion capture systems, and advanced video analysis software are all being refined and commercialized by Irish tech firms.
The precision offered by these technological solutions allows for highly personalized training programs. By meticulously tracking biometric data, movement patterns, and even psychological factors, Dublin-based innovators are helping athletes push their boundaries safely and effectively. This data-driven approach is not just for elite professionals; it’s increasingly being democratized, making advanced performance analysis accessible to a wider range of athletes and sports organizations.
Enhancing Fan Engagement in the Digital Age
Beyond the field of play, Dublin’s tech companies are also redefining the fan experience. Innovative applications and platforms are emerging that foster deeper connections between sports organizations and their supporters. This includes the development of interactive fan zones, augmented reality (AR) experiences during games, and sophisticated social media integration tools that allow for real-time engagement. The goal is to create a more immersive and participatory environment for fans, regardless of their physical location.
These technologies are crucial in an era where digital interaction often complements or even replaces traditional spectating. Dublin-based developers are creating virtual reality (VR) viewing experiences, personalized content delivery systems, and gamified fan loyalty programs. These efforts aim to boost engagement, increase revenue streams for sports entities, and ensure that fans feel a constant connection to their teams and the sport they love.
Streamlining Sports Management and Operations
The operational side of sports is also being significantly optimized by Dublin’s tech prowess. From league management software to ticketing platforms and merchandise logistics, companies in the city are creating integrated solutions that improve efficiency and reduce costs. These advancements allow sports organizations to focus more on their core activities of competition and fan engagement, while their back-end operations are handled with cutting-edge technological support.
Blockchain technology, for instance, is being explored by some Dublin firms for its potential in secure ticketing and transparent player contract management. Similarly, AI is being used to optimize scheduling, manage facility usage, and even personalize marketing efforts to specific fan demographics. This comprehensive approach to operational efficiency is a key contribution of Dublin’s tech scene to the global sports industry.
